15 lines
328 B
Python
15 lines
328 B
Python
|
import pytest
|
||
|
|
||
|
import ifaddr
|
||
|
|
||
|
|
||
|
def test_get_adapters():
|
||
|
"""Test 'get_adapters' against 'lo' interface."""
|
||
|
lo_ips = [
|
||
|
n.ip if not isinstance(n.ip, tuple) else n.ip[0]
|
||
|
for a in ifaddr.get_adapters() if a.name == "lo"
|
||
|
for n in a.ips
|
||
|
]
|
||
|
assert "127.0.0.1" in lo_ips
|
||
|
assert "::1" in lo_ips
|